産

Produce, Product, Birth

う(γ‚€) (umu), う(γΎγ‚Œγ‚‹) (umareru)

JLPT N4

Interesting Fact

The kanji 産 appears in γŠεœŸη”£ (omiyage), meaning 'souvenir.' In Japan, bringing omiyage back from trips is an important social custom.

Memory Trick

Imagine a factory producing goods on a conveyor belt. That production process helps you remember 産 means 'produce.'

Readings

Onyomi: ァン (san)

Kunyomi: う(γ‚€) (umu), う(γΎγ‚Œγ‚‹) (umareru)

Example Words

γŠεœŸη”£
γŠγΏγ‚„γ’ (omiyage)
Souvenir
η”Ÿη”£
せいさん (seisan)
Production
国産
こくさん (kokusan)
Domestic product
出産
しゅっさん (shussan)
Childbirth

Example Sentence

京都で γŠεœŸη”£γ‚’ θ²·γ„γΎγ—γŸγ€‚

きょうとで γŠγΏγ‚„γ’γ‚’ γ‹γ„γΎγ—γŸγ€‚

Kyouto de omiyage o kaimashita

I bought souvenirs in Kyoto.
